ERA's Brian Rugg Featured in Today's Herald

By Micaela Carucci

If you picked up a copy of today’s Boston Herald, make sure to check out the article about Curt Schilling selling his Medfield home. ERA Boston Real Estate Group’s own Brian Rugg appears in the article to give his expert commentary and advice to this Schillings, who are having trouble selling the house. Here is part of the article: 

 

"We’re guessing that former Red Sox ace Curt Schilling has a pretty good retirement plan now that he’s decided to hang ’em up. Because No. 38’s investment in Massachusetts real estate hasn’t exactly been keeping him in clean socks!

Schilling, who just announced his retirement from baseball, has lowered the price on his marvy Medfield manse to $5 million - some $3 million less than when he first put it on the market.

Now that’s a steal!

The 11,000-square-foot, three-story house, with attached eight-car garage, has been on the market for more than a year - with no takers.

So last week, Schilling and his bride, Shonda, bit the bullet and shaved a whopping $3 million off the price.

“A basic rule in the world of real estate is this: if something is on the market at a certain price and it doesn’t sell for a year, it’s overpriced,” said Brian Rugg, a Realtor at ERA Boston Real Estate Group and the author of the Boston Real Estate Report, which tracks housing sales in Greater Boston. “You don’t have to be a professional to figure that out.”
